Biz: Futurist Ross Dawson: Newspapers dead in the U.S. by 2017

  • Leading futurist Ross Dawson has a message for you print jockeys out there: Find another medium that doesn’t involve dead trees. The dude created a handy-dandy chart explaining how we won’t read newspapers in the U.S. in another seven years. But on the plus side, if you’re a member of the Argentinian press, your papers will still be relevant into 2039. Food for thought.
